What the creator captured
Brennen Taylor explored the unique world of Facebook Marketplace dining, starting with a $47 homemade Japanese meal that featured a variety of rice balls and a curry plate. While he appreciated the hustle of the independent cook, he found the salmon and tuna options a bit plain and lacking necessary sauces. His most memorable moment was the wholesome interaction with the seller's excited children before heading to a pizza shop for a mysterious Egyptian meal.
